How does an ADHD assessment work?

The process of assessing may differ from practitioner to practitioner, but it generally will begin with a thorough interview that includes medical, family and environmental background. They will ask how symptoms have affected daily mood, productivity, and relationships, as well as whether there are any other conditions causing these symptoms. They'll also request information from people who are familiar with the patient (e.g. For adults, they might request information from spouses parents, siblings, or spouse; for children, a teacher, coach or the nanny. This personal perspective can provide important clues not found in questionnaires.

They will then use diagnostic criteria to determine if you or your child is suffering from ADHD symptoms. Usually, this involves having six or more established symptoms of inattention and/or hyperactivity/impulsivity across multiple settings, such as home and school, for six months. Doctors will also consider the patient's age, the medication they are taking and any other mental health issues that may be present.

After the clinical interview has been completed, they are likely to conduct various tests to gauge the patient's performance. These include psychometric tests with a broad range of spectral to detect psychiatric disorders and also more specific neuropsychological tests that examine specific abilities such as memory recall and motor abilities. Depending on the person who is being evaluated, they could be asked to complete detailed lists of their own symptoms or to evaluate them using scales of rating like the Connors III Inventory of ADHD symptoms.

It is crucial to be honest during the evaluation. It can be difficult to admit that you or your child are having trouble staying focused in their attention, paying attention, or staying on track. However being honest can help the doctor get more precise information and determine if there are other causes.

What if I don't get an answer to my question?

Some people suffering from ADHD aren't diagnosed by a medical professional. This could be due to various reasons. It isn't easy to obtain a referral from your GP. Furthermore, some doctors might have preconceived notions regarding what ADHD is and who it affects. This can make it difficult to receive a proper diagnosis, particularly for people who are of color, are born in a woman's birth or do not speak English natively.

If you are unable to receive a reliable diagnosis through the NHS you can usually visit a private clinic to pay for a diagnostic examination. These clinics are required to adhere to the National Institute of Clinical Excellence guidelines when diagnosing ADHD in adults. They should still conduct an exhaustive evaluation of symptoms, conduct a cognitive screening and administer ADHD tests such as the checklist of symptoms.

After being assessed and if it is found that you have ADHD, your clinician will provide guidance on how to manage your symptoms, and may prescribe medication if needed. The dosage of the medication will depend on your individual needs and the severity of your symptoms.
